What is red quinoa?

Red quinoa is a variety of quinoa that has a dark red color and a slightly nuttier flavor compared to white quinoa. It is a highly nutritious grain that is high in protein, fiber, and various vitamins and minerals. Red quinoa is considered a complete protein, meaning it contains all nine essential amino acids that the body needs.

Red quinoa is often used in salads, soups, and side dishes as a healthy and gluten-free alternative to grains like rice or pasta. It can be cooked in the same way as white quinoa, by boiling it in water until it is tender and the germ has spiraled out from the seed.

Overall, red quinoa is a versatile and nutritious ingredient that can be easily incorporated into a healthy diet.
